At Yesterdays Royal, a Victorian-era restaurant and ice cream shop, you may find a ghostly woman who haunts the dining room. Another ghost, nicknamed Jack, is said to inhabit the second floor.

    I worked at Yesterday’s Royale for seasons, from 1980-1983… All waiters and waitresses wore period clothing. I made my victorian style dresses and the guys wore knickers with suspenders. It had a fine dining room and a more informal cafe room where they served fish fry dinners every Friday night.
